Summary: Security update for GraphicsMagick
Details: This update for GraphicsMagick fixes the following issues: - CVE-2017-15033: A denial of service attack (memory leak) in ReadYUVImage in coders/yuv.c was fixed (bsc#1061873) - CVE-2017-13063: A heap-based buffer overflow vulnerability in the function GetStyleTokens in coders/svg.c was fixed (bsc#1055050) - CVE-2017-13064: A heap-based buffer overflow vulnerability in the function GetStyleTokens in coders/svg.c was fixed (bsc#1055042) - CVE-2017-12936: The ReadWMFImage function in coders/wmf.c in GraphicsMagick had a use-after-free issue for data associated with exception reporting. (bsc#1054598) - CVE-2017-13139: The ReadOneMNGImage function in coders/png.c had an out-of-bounds read with the MNG CLIP chunk. (bsc#1055430) - CVE-2017-12937: The ReadSUNImage function in coders/sun.c in GraphicsMagick had a colormap heap-based buffer over-read. (bsc#1054596) - CVE-2017-11534: A Memory Leak in the lite_font_map() function in coders/wmf.c was fixed (bsc#1050135)
